Republican lawmakers will introduce a brand new invoice Wednesday to speed up the Protection Division’s use of quantum info science, from sensing and navigation to extra bold objectives of quantum computing for superior synthetic intelligence functions.
Rep. Elise Stefanik, R-N.Y., and Sen. Marsha Blackburn, R-Tenn., will introduce the Protection Quantum Acceleration Act. The laws would direct the Protection Division to determine a brand new quantum advisor function and arise a middle of excellence to “discover and determine [quantum information science] applied sciences which have demonstrated worth in advancing the priorities and missions of the Division,” in line with the textual content of the invoice, seen solely by Protection One.
Quantum info science, which takes benefit of the distinctive properties of quantum mechanics, has many potential protection functions. Info that’s encrypted on the quantum stage can’t be secretly intercepted as a result of making an attempt to measure a quantum property modifications it. Quantum sensors can relay details about location, making them a safer technique of navigation than GPS, which might be spoofed. Quantum computer systems, immediately of their infancy, might finally course of info exponentially extra successfully than typical computer systems. The Nationwide Academies of Sciences has mentioned “quantum computer systems are the one identified mannequin for computing that might supply exponential speedup over immediately’s computer systems.”
However China has outpaced the Protection Division by way of funding in quantum know-how, dedicating $15 billion over the following 5 years—or $3 billion a yr—versus the $700 million yearly Protection Division funding.
The brand new invoice doesn’t push the Protection Division to match China’s numbers, as non-public firms like IBM, Google, and Lockheed Martin are additionally closely spending analysis and growth {dollars} on next-generation quantum computing. Nevertheless it does elevate the profile of quantum know-how inside the Protection Division and, theoretically, would enable the Pentagon to begin shopping for extra quantum applied sciences sooner, enabling faster innovation from non-public firms.
“Quantum’s influence on our nationwide safety will likely be appreciable, and we should take fast steps to make sure america is the primary nation to succeed in quantum benefit. This invoice will make sure the Division of Protection, led by the unbelievable work at [The U.S. Air Force Rome Laboratory in New York] is ready to outpace our adversaries and quickly develop and transition quantum applied sciences to our service members,” Stefanik mentioned in a press release.
The Protection Division already has a director of quantum science within the workplace of the undersecretary for analysis and engineering. Beneath the invoice, the newly-established quantum advisor would have a much-expanded function, coordinating with combatant instructions on the place they may want or use quantum science, coordinating with allies like Australia to share information and greatest practices, and particularly wanting on the challenges the Protection Division faces to find out if quantum info science would possibly assist.
The invoice would additionally direct the stand-up of a middle to coordinate with companies and academia and develop prototypes of extra near-term quantum applied sciences for sensing and navigation, along with accelerating quantum computing analysis.
